His sights are set on S'pore

53-year-old Australian property and retail magnate Mr Brett Blundy is the latest mega-wealthy foreigner to make Singapore home.  On possible reactions from Singaporeans, SMU Assistant Professor of Law Eugene Tan said: “I think (this phenomenon) will elicit a mix of sentiments... There are some who might feel that Singapore has become a playground for the rich and famous. Another way you can see it is as a thumbs-up for Singapore – these people feel comfortable operating in Singapore. We have to recognise that as a global city, we have to be open to a large variety of people.” He added: “It's also about getting people who move here to be sensitive to local concerns and needs, to recognise there are responsibilities to being part of Singapore, and not to engage in ostentatious displays of wealth…Whether they stay in the medium or long term, they should try to reach out to Singaporeans and Singaporeans should also try to reach out to them."
